Introduced by Google and heavily customized by Huawei under EMUI/HarmonyOS, FRP triggers automatically when a device is factory reset outside of the standard settings menu (e.g., via Recovery Mode). The phone demands the original Google Account credentials previously synced to the device. If forgotten, the phone becomes a "brick." Network/SIM Locks

Huawei devices have strict region and model variants (e.g., VOG-L29 for the Huawei P30 Pro). Flashing a file meant for a different variant will hard-brick your device. Find your exact model via the recovery screen or fastboot mode before downloading anything. Step 2: Download the Correct Drivers

For modern Huawei devices, software exploits from within the operating system are frequently patched. To communicate directly with the Kirin boot ROM (BootROM), technicians must use a physical "Test Point."
